The Manger, Commercial Launch is responsible for the overall successful commercialization of large-scale New Product Introduction (NPI) projects for Canada.
Successful commercialization is defined as flawless execution for on-time, on-target delivery of NPIs to a primed marketplace.
This includes but is not limited to: the tactical execution and management of the pre-launch and post-launch commercialization process from initial concept through sustained marketplace viability.
Working with and through cross-functional teams; this individual is required to identify, signal, and resolve issues, preemptively mitigate risks, coordinate, validate, execute, audit, and communicate launch status updates.
Serving as the passionate and engaged expert, and the voice of the product launches to both internal and external audiences.
What you’ll do:
• Execute, manage, and elevate New Product Introduction (NPI) projects, including review and refinement of launch scope and timing.
• Execute, manage, and elevate all aspects of project management on a day-to-day basis, across all functions of the commercialization process. Leveraging centralized web-based project management platforms.
• Execute, manage, and elevate day-to-day tracking of milestones and deliverables by signaling obstacles and proactively mitigating risk.
• Execute, manage, and elevate communication of NPI product benefits, line ups, launch timing and details to all audiences.
• Execute, manage, and elevate timely, accurate, actionable reporting to stakeholders, customers and interested executives by collecting, analyzing, validating, and cascading status reports, dashboards, and scorecards.
• Drive, support, communicate, and elevate the transition planning process to continually improve phase out of previous generation, and phase in of NPI.
• Work with and through cross functional teams to strategize solutions and identify opportunities for improvement.
• Work with and through cross functional teams both internal, external, and third-party as needed to meet delivery needs for key initiatives.
• Work collaboratively with leadership to define and implement plans for improvement and to drive results and outcomes.
• Articulate goals to project team on an on-going basis.
• Motivate integrated and cross-functional teams to exceed goals.
• Serve as the primary source of information for all aspects of active projects.
• Continue to strengthen project management within Commercialization with ongoing review and evaluation of project management and Agile practices.
